Factors that Affect Solar Panel Costs in Clearfield

The cost of installing a solar system in Clearfield can vary by more than $10,000 from home to home. Your actual cost depends on several factors. The largest one is the size of the system your home needs, and other factors include the equipment you choose, financing options and the solar company you choose.

Solar Equipment

When it comes to estimating the cost of a solar panel system in Clearfield, one of the most crucial factors is the size of the system you need. Solar systems are sized by kilowatts (kW) and are primarily based on your home’s energy usage, which you can gauge by looking at past energy bills. Your total cost can increase by about $3,290 for each additional kilowatt you need.The brand and kind of equipment you get for your solar system can raise or lower the price quite significantly. If you prefer a brand name like Tesla or SunPower, these are often more expensive than other brands. Efficiency also matters. Whether you’re opting for high efficiency because you have limited roof space or just want maximum energy production, you can expect a higher equipment cost, but this can typically lead to more savings over time. Also, if you want extra equipment like an electric vehicle charger or solar batteries, this will also raise the cost.

Solar Financing Terms

If paying for a solar system out of pocket is out of reach, solar loans are a solid option because they lower your upfront costs and allow you to pay for your system over five to seven years on average.However, the interest on solar loans also increases your total costs, so it’s crucial to consider that as well. You can always bring down the total you pay in interest and possibly even your APR by making a larger down payment.

Solar Panel Installation Company

The solar company you select will play a role in your total cost to make the switch to solar . Different companies will charge different amounts for the equipment and labor.Larger national companies generally have lower costs, but some local companies keep up with them by offering sales and discounts. While the smaller companies might not have specific equipment options like Tesla Powerwall batteries or additional services like electric car charger installation, they might be cheaper overall.

How to Save on Solar Panels

The company that does your solar panel installation will affect the warranties and brands available to you, and it will also have an impact on your total cost. Since picking a company can be difficult, we have some tips to help you, such as:

  • Reputation: Make sure your solar panel installer has a good reputation by confirming it has certifications and licenses, checking how long it's been in business and reading reviews by previous customers and solar experts like the EcoWatch team.
  • Contract: Before signing a contract with a solar installer, make sure you read it through carefully so you understand the terms. Also, ask questions if you’re not sure about some of the terms, such as what to do if a component breaks or malfunctions and if there are any guarantees about energy production.
  • Solar Panel Brands: Not all solar installers offer the same brands of solar panels, so the brand and type of panel you want can play a large role in the company you hire.
  • Installation Process: When going solar, it’s crucial to keep an open line of communication with your solar panel company. See to it that you understand how the installation process will go and the project timeline.

EcoWatch's Clearfield, UT Solar Cost FAQs

How much does it cost to install solar panels in Clearfield?

The average cost of solar panels in Clearfield is about $16,450 for a 5-kW system and $32,900 for a 10-kW system before the ITC, but the real cost will depend on certain factors such as the kind of solar panels you want, what size system you need and how much energy you consume.

Is cost the most important thing to consider when buying solar panels?

Cost is without a doubt one of the most important factors you should consider when buying solar panels, but other important factors include efficiency, durability, and quality.

Is it worth going solar in Clearfield?

Solar panels can be a great investment for a majority of homeowners, but they might not be worth it for everyone. If your home doesn't get a lot of direct sunlight and/or your electricity bills are already reasonably low, solar panels might not be for you.

How long do solar panels last in Clearfield?

Though the average lifespan of solar panels is 25 to 30 years, that doesn't mean they are completely unusable at that time. What this means is how much energy they produce will have decreased significantly after that point. You can replace them after having them for that long or you can continue to use them at a lower efficiency.
